Abstract

The ARGO-YBJ experiment has been in full and stable data taking at the Yangbajing cosmic ray observatory (Tibet, P.R. China, 4300 m a.s.l.) for more than five years. The detector has been designed in order to explore the Cosmic Ray (CR) spectrum in an energy range from few TeV up to several PeV. The high segmentation of the detector allows a detailed measurement of the lateral particle distribution which can be exploited on order to identify showers produced by primaries of different mass. The results of the measurement of the all-particle and proton plus helium energy spectra in the energy region between 1012 and 1016 eV are discussed.
